EBE Technologies, East Moline, Ill., developer of enterprise business process management software for the transportation industry, hosted its first annual User Conference and Vendor Exhibition themed "Driving Action, Delivering Results", in Oak Brook, Ill., last month.
The conference consisted of more than 20 educational sessions focused on industry topics and technology solutions to meet the challenges of today's trucking environment.
Keynote speaker Bob Costello, chief economist for the American Trucking Association, spoke on diesel fuel prices and practical strategies for motor carriers. His message focused on the many reasons the price of crude oil has surged, the annual diesel expense, consumption within the trucking industry and strategies to conserve fuel while boosting MPG, reducing idling, and driver variability.
"Because there is no one reason for the cause of rising fuel prices, there is no one magic bullet to correct the problem," said Costello. "While we are currently experiencing a decrease in fuel costs, we will most likely never go back to the prices of even a year ago. It's not the increase in cost that has affected the industry so dramatically, but it is the rate at which prices increased -- not giving carriers the ability to respond," he added.
The conference included breakout and general sessions presented by EBE staff, industry leaders such as TMW Systems, Qualcomm, and PeopleNet and EBE customers. Packard Logistics, DistTech and Modern Transportation presented case studies detailing their business growth through EBE's process management software.
